Last year, WhatsApp added a new "View Once" feature that enables users to communicate images and videos that vanish after being viewed, just as you can with Snapchat and Instagram.
The company now wants to go even farther with that function by prohibiting screenshots and screen captures for "View Once" photos and movies.
The most recent WhatsApp beta release for iPhone users, which is now available on TestFlight, prohibits screenshots and screen recordings for anything transmitted with the "View Once" option, according to WABetaInfo,
A notification stating that the screenshot attempt was "restricted for increased privacy" is now displayed by WhatsApp whenever someone tries to snap one while viewing "View Once" media.
To protect the person who supplied the screenshot or video, the final snapshot or screen recording will also display this notice rather than the actual content, as seen by WABetaInfo.
